Transaction 4bdb93a349ebed415ce0897490410706680ccf37e50504f1ce68bfb8f27c2f4a

3 Input
2 Outputs
  • 4bdb93a349ebed415ce0897490410706680ccf37e50504f1ce68bfb8f27c2f4a:0
  • value  1691061
    address  37ADxtsKsX18ionNuqas4nGRBUkfZWLNaN
  • 4bdb93a349ebed415ce0897490410706680ccf37e50504f1ce68bfb8f27c2f4a:1
  • value  3909945
    address  152Szzc4ERbp4qTNtGYjkLKQ1uXbL93rJ5